Anyway, the Apple Watch was useful in yet another situation that ended up in the media. According to Australian newspapers, a 24-year-old was able to detect a serious health problem thanks to the watch.
Mike Love said that his watch alerted him at dawn that his heart rate was way above normal. In general, in a resting state, the rate does not exceed 60 times per minute. In Mike's case, the clock read about 130 to 140 beats per minute.
As soon as Mike went to an emergency doctor, he ended up finding a serious health problem that had been present since his childhood.

Mike needed surgery after the problem was discovered. The young man is already at rest.
"I don't think I could live without the Apple Watch right now. I love it for the convenience, but also the fact that it just found something I had no idea about, which potentially saved my life," the boy said after the surgery.
